Resolution Ordering the Improvements and Authorizing the Preparation of Plans and
Specifications for 215th Street Improvements, City Project 26-09
WHEREAS, on July 6, 2026, the City Council fixed a date for a public hearing for the proposed
improvements of 215' Street from Kenrick Avenue (CSAH 5) to Juniper Way (CSAH 70),
including a utility crossing of Interstate 35, City Project 26-09; and
WHEREAS, the required published notices of hearing (improvement) through a weekly
publication were given, the required mailed notice of the hearing (improvement) was given to each
property owner in the proposed assessment area at least ten days prior to the hearing
(improvement), and the hearing (improvement) was held on August 3, 2026, at which time all
persons desiring to be heard were given an opportunity to be heard.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, by the City Council of Lakeville, Minnesota:
1. The 2151 Street Improvements are hereby ordered as detailed in the feasibility report for
City Project 26-09, dated June 30, 2026 and revised July 27, 2026.
2. The City expects to issue bonds for the project costs.
3. The estimated project cost is $8,268,850 and anticipated funding sources are listed below.
City staff is hereby authorized to make the appropriate transfers between funds with respect
to the non -debt project funding sources up to 10% above the estimated costs. Funding
transfers may include loans between funds to cover engineering and other costs incurred
on the project in advance of received bond proceeds.
4. The City Engineer is hereby authorized to prepare plans and specifications for the making
of such improvements.
